Description

With special permission by the Frank Lloyd Wright Foundation, Japanese lighting brand Yamagiwa presents the cherry Taliesin 2 Floor Lamp. The design is inspired by Wright's Taliesin 1 Pendant Light, an original design that was created to illuminate a theatre at the architect's 1911 residence in Taliesin, Wisconsin. The Frank Lloyd Wright Foundation and Frank Lloyd Wright School of Architecture are now both located at this very same location. Crafted from cherry wood, the material was chosen after Wright's favourite colour, red. The sculptural lamp consists of a series of boxes which contain the light sources, each reflecting off the boards placed above and below them. Care instructions: Dust using a dry cloth. Requires 10 x Max 25W E14 bulbs (not included)

A Legacy in Design

The Conran Shop started in 1972 on London's Fulham Road and quickly became a favourite for design lovers everywhere. It's more than just a store; it's where you find some of the best modern furniture, lights, and home items. Today, people know The Conran Shop as a place where great designs are carefully picked and presented.

The Visionary Sir Terence Conran

Sir Terence Conran was a man of many talents - from designing to running restaurants and writing books. He started The Conran Shop with one clear idea great design should be for everyone. He changed the way many of us think about our homes. Even today, the shop follows his big ideas and values.
